What made INF treaty different from its predecessors

Answer:

The difference between the Intermediate-Range Nuclear Forces Treaty from the predecessors is that the contract of INF was forbidding all the ballistic and land missiles.

Explanation:

This contract about nuclear forces was making the United States and the Soviet Union to get rid of all ballistic and land-based missiles that had the range from 500 to 5500 kilometers.
